iHeartMedia Names Sam Englebardt to Board of Directors

iHeartMedia names Galaxy Interactive General Partner Sam Englebardt to its board of directors. Galaxy Interactive is a venture capital franchise focused on companies operating at the intersection of content, finance and technology, with a particular emphasis on video game studios, NFTs, social platforms and financial marketplaces.

Englebardt, a media and technology investor and content producer, has experience at the intersection of content and exponential technologies, including the metaverse and web3. He is also co-founder and Partner at Galaxy Digital, a technology-driven financial services and investment management firm that provides institutions and clients with a full suite of financial solutions spanning the digital assets ecosystem.

"Sam's expertise and deep understanding of web3, exponential technologies and the potential of emerging consumer tech platforms like NFTs, tokens and shared virtual experiences, combined with his background in media and entertainment, will be uniquely valuable to us as we extend iHeart's presence into web3 and the metaverse," said iHeartMedia Chairman and CEO Bob Pittman.

Prior to Galaxy Digital, Englebardt was a Partner and Managing Director at Lambert Media Group (LMG), where he where helped source and oversaw investments in Rave Cinemas (sold to Cinemark), Gold Class Cinemas (sold to iPic) and Demarest Films and managed a portfolio of early-stage media tech venture investments. He also previously served as Vice President and Financial Advisor at Alliance Bernstein and is a licensed attorney in California.
